Gulf Air wins Superbrands award

Bahrain's national carrier Gulf Air has been declared a 2009 'Superbrand' at the annual gala Superbrands awards held in Dubai recently.

Article continues below
 
A panel of 12 Superbrand Council Members together with the votes of some 500 CEOs and members of senior management from several corporate establishments in the region adjudged Gulf Air as a "Superbrand".

Gulf Air won this award in competition with over 1800 established brands in the region including several airlines such as Air Arabia, Air India, British Airways, Cathay Pacific, Emirates, Etihad, KLM, Lufthansa, Singapore Airlines and Virgin Atlantic.

The Superbrands organisation is acclaimed worldwide as being an independent authority and arbiter of branding excellence and is committed to paying tribute to exceptional brands and promoting the discipline of branding. The award recognises outstanding brand qualities identified with a particular brand name.

Only brands that achieve the level of recognition set by the independent Superbrands Council are eligible for inclusion in the Superbrands book, which is well recognized in the corporate world.

About Gulf Air
Founded in 1950, Gulf Air is the proud national carrier of the Kingdom of Bahrain. Having been operating for over half a Century, it ranks as one of the oldest airlines in the Middle East region.

Though it continually strives to develop; its goal has remained unchanged, to maintain a constant commitment to the latest aviation technology and an adherence to traditional Arabian hospitality. It is currently owned by Bahrain Mumtalakat Holdings Company.

One of the prime motives of the carrier is to link Bahrain to the GCC as well as connect it to the rest of the world. The airline's network stretches from Europe to Asia, connecting 41 cities in 27 countries, with a current fleet consisting of 32 aircraft.

Renown for its direct network to its non-stop flights schedules, Gulf Air covers the Middle East, the Americas, Africa and Asia-Pacific.

The airline's business strategy is to re-fleet itself over the next five years to further strengthen its presence and continue its aim to become the carrier of choice. It recently signed a deal with Boeing worth nearly US$ 6 billion to purchase up to 24 Boeing 787 aircraft, and another deal with Airbus for 35 aircraft, including A320s and A330s.

Gulf Air is the Official Airline and Sponsor of the Gulf Air Bahrain Grand Prix 2009 and London based football club Queens Park Rangers.
